Heavy rainfall raises alerts further inland

The current onshore flow passing over Prince Rupert has raised concerns further inland regarding rivers and streams that feed into the Skeena and Nass Rivers.

The BC Environment Rivers Forecast Centre has issued a high streamflow advisory for the North Coast, with particular attention being paid to the Kitimat, Kitsumkalum (Dutch Valley), and Bear (Stewart) rivers, and other smaller tributaries of the Nass and lower Skeena rivers.
